Robert D. Fraser, of Malden, passed away unexpectedly on  February 9th, at his home in Malden, MA.  He was born in Norwood, MA, in 1955.  He will be greatly missed. 

He is survived by his parents, Richard and Gerry Fraser of Dennisport, MA, his mother, Joan Fraser of Kingston, MA, his son , Beau B. Fraser of Amherst, NH, his sister, Lee Fraser of Malden, MA< and his aunt, Helen Miklas of Falmouth.

Robert was a graduate of Walpole High School.  After his graduation he attended Graham Junior College in Boston.  For over 20 years, he worked at the Polaroid Corporation as a Chemical Processor, mainly at building W-2.  More recently, he held a similar position at Lubrizol Corp. in Wilmington, MA.

Robert enjoyed 10 years as half of the competitive barbecue team “Back 40 BBQ” with his sister, and was a member of the New England Barbecue Society and the Kansas City Barbecue Society.  Their team won two Massachusetts State Barbecue Chmpionships.  Robert also got to see his beloved Red Sox win two World Series.
